About Programme
The undergraduate programme focuses on developing mathematical skills in algebra, calculus, and data analysis. Students who are interested in pure math and are interested in interpreting data, finding patterns, and determining conclusions are good candidates for a B. Sc. (Hons.) Mathematics degree. After your graduation from a B. Sc.  (Hons.) Mathematics degree, you can pursue courses like MCA, M. Sc.  IT, and actuarial sciences, MBA or M. Sc. in Mathematics. To get the most out of this course, it’s best to immediately pursue higher studies after having completed your graduation. The world is your oyster afterwards, with a plethora of opportunities in research, academia, and technical institutes.

Career Prospects
Career opportunities can include jobs at financial companies, software developers, marketers and bankers; everyone wants a good mathematician. In applied mathematics, you’ll have to creatively solve problems in business and social domains. Data analytics, a field which is the talk of town, often needs people who are good with numbers and understand data. With excellent mathematical abilities, you might just be picked up by political or military intelligence bodies to work as a crypto analyst who deciphers encrypted messages.
